The film is based on the real estate boom of Pune city in the period of early 2000. At that time a lot of MNCs setup their operations near the scenic Mulshi region, which also gave rise to large residential projects in the nearby Kothrud region of Pune.
Farmers sold their land to builders, but could not handle sudden rise in wealth. They spent the money lavish weddings, dowry & junket which they cannot afford. In few years they are rendered deep in debt & without any source of income. I have see this happening around me.
I am not a fan of violence & the level of violence in the film is something that I would desist & not suitable for kids below 12 yrs. However the performances & direction is top class. This is one of those rare films where almost every actor gets into character, which gives a smooth flow to the narration of the film & has a tight grip on the viewer attention.
The title 'Mulsi Pattern' refers to brutal killings carried out by gangster originating from Mulshi region who sold their farms to property developers & were rendered without any source of income. The film is based on rivalry of real-life gangsters Sandeep Mohol & Ganesh Marne gang.
